Charlotte and Billy Caldwell left Omagh today, kicking off day 2 of their 150 mile walk to Belfast.
'Billy's Cannabus Walk'
Q Radio bumped into them as they were leaving the town, heading off to Ballygawley.
Yesterday they travelled 17.5 miles from Castlederg to Omagh.
Charlotte said the first day of the walk went really well and that Billy was in great spirits. He walked most of the way and only sat in his buggy for a little while when he got tired.
They were due to leave Omagh Courthouse at half 9 but were an hour late in making tracks.
Billy wasn't too keen on leaving his bed this morning but was in great form when Q Radio spoke to them.
